Is it possible to do dynamic charting when the data set is horizontal (in rows)? All the great sites with examples from Google are all shown with column data.

Normally I just transpose the data set, but I'm not the only one who puts in new data, so it would be alot of help if it's possible to do the offset function in rows?

Why does 9 mean SUM in SUBTOTAL?
It is because Sum is the 9th alphabetically in Average, Count, CountA, Max, Min, Product, StDev.S, StDev.P, Sum, VAR.S, VAR.P.
The OFFSET function works equally well horizontally.

Instead of something like this:
=OFFSET($G$1,0,0,COUNTA($G:$G)-1)

You just have something like this:
=OFFSET($A$7,0,0,1,COUNTA($7:$7)-1)

(Mind the positions of your arguments. The width is in a different place than the height.)
